Columbia/Legacy: C2K 65774 (CK 65775--CK 65776). Jazz. Originally released in 1970. Compact disc. Program notes by Ralph J. Gleason and Bob Belden (25 p. : ports.) inserted in container. Miles Davis, trumpet ; Wayne Shorter, soprano saxophone ; Bennie Maupin, bass clarinet (1st-5th and 7th works) ; Joe Zawinul, Chick Corea, Larry Young (1st and 3rd works), electric piano ; John McLaughlin, guitar ; Dave Holland, bass/electric bass ; Harvey Brooks, electric bass (1st-3rd and 5th works) ; Lenny White (1st-4th works), Jack DeJohnette, Billy Cobham (7th work), drums ; Don Alias, congas, drums (1st-6th works) ; Jumma Santos (Jim Riley), shaker, congas (1st-6th works) ; Airto Moreira, cuica, percussion (7th work). Recorded Aug. 19-21, 1969, and Jan. 28, 1970 (7th work), in Columbia Studio B, New York City.
